[发明专利]一种基于区块链的公共空间数据共享方法在审
申请号: | 202010789922.0 | 申请日: | 2020-08-07 |
公开(公告)号: | CN111881218A | 公开(公告)日: | 2020-11-03 |
发明(设计)人: | 杨璐绮;李海坤;李子豪 | 申请(专利权)人: | 江苏哩咕信息科技有限公司 |
主分类号: | G06F16/27 | 分类号: | G06F16/27;G06Q20/38 |
代理公司: | 深圳紫晴专利代理事务所(普通合伙) 44646 | 代理人: | 程玉红 |
地址: | 210000 江苏省南京市*** | 国省代码: | 江苏;32 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 基于 区块 公共 空间 数据 共享 方法 | ||
本发明公开了一种基于区块链的公共空间数据共享方法,包括依照关键词区分并截取待共享数据,并分别上传至区块链网络;在所述区块链网络上生成各数据节点,所述数据节点包括不同所述关键词及其对应的所述待共享数据;接受数据请求指令,并依据所述指令对应选择所述数据节点;通过数据共享接口实现所述数据节点中数据的共享,通过将待共享数据按关键词和具体摘要信息进行比对进行区分和截取,而后压缩数据包生成二次数据节点,同时增加保密签名确保信息的不公开且不外泄,进一步通过限制传输速率确保区块链的流畅运行。
技术领域
本发明涉及数据处理的技术领域,尤其涉及一种基于区块链的公共空间数据共享方法。
背景技术
区块链从本质上讲是一个共享数据库,存储于其中的数据或信息,具有“不可伪造”、“全程留痕”、“可以追溯”、“公开透明”、“集体维护”等特征。作为一种新型的去中心化协议,能够安全的存储数据,信息不可伪造和篡改,可以智能执行智能合约,无需任何中心化机构的审核。基于这些特征,区块链技术奠定了坚实的信任基础,创造了可靠的合作机制,具有广阔的运用前景。
目前,基于区块链的数据共享方法采用区块链技术进行数据共享,数据提供节点将数据同步到区块链上,区块链将数据从区块链同步到数据获取节点。但是,这种数据共享方法用到公共数据的共享上存在一定缺陷,一方面由于目前共享公共数据量的加大,节点量变多,导致区块链的运行效率受到影响,另一方面也没在一定程度上保障数据的隐私性,在共享的过程中存在数据泄露的风险。
发明内容
本部分的目的在于概述本发明的实施例的一些方面以及简要介绍一些较佳实施例。在本部分以及本申请的说明书摘要和发明名称中可能会做些简化或省略以避免使本部分、说明书摘要和发明名称的目的模糊,而这种简化或省略不能用于限制本发明的范围。
鉴于上述现有基于区块链的数据共享方法存在的问题,提出了本发明。
因此,本发明解决的技术问题是:解决现有基于区块链的公共数据共享方法一方面易导致区块链的运行效率受到影响,另一方面在共享的过程中也存在数据泄露风险的问题。
为解决上述技术问题,本发明提供如下技术方案:一种基于区块链的公共空间数据共享方法,包括依照关键词区分并截取待共享数据,并分别上传至区块链网络;在所述区块链网络上生成各数据节点,所述数据节点包括不同所述关键词及其对应的所述待共享数据;接受数据请求指令,并依据所述指令对应选择所述数据节点;通过数据共享接口实现所述数据节点中数据的共享。
作为本发明所述的基于区块链的公共空间数据共享方法的一种优选方案,其中:依照所述关键词区分并截取所述待共享数据,并分别上传至所述区块链网络包括基于预设算法,对所述待共享数据进行摘要,获取摘要信息;比对所述关键词进行所述待共享数据的区分;依照区分结果截取后将所述摘要信息发送至所述区块链网络进行存证,并接收返回的当前所述共享数据存证的交易地址;将所述交易地址、所述关键词及其截取的所述待共享数据组成截取数据包,在所述区块链网络上生成各所述数据节点。
作为本发明所述的基于区块链的公共空间数据共享方法的一种优选方案,其中:生成所述截取数据包后进行压缩预处理,确定压缩后的各所述待共享数据的节点位置变化信息,并记录压缩后的数据流大小。
作为本发明所述的基于区块链的公共空间数据共享方法的一种优选方案,其中:进行压缩处理后还包括确定所述待共享数据是否有需要加密的部分;若存在,则计算相应部分压缩后的所述截取数据包的哈希值和私钥;获取其签名信息,并上传所述私钥至智能合约,通过与所述智能合约交互存储相应加密部分的数据元信息。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于江苏哩咕信息科技有限公司,未经江苏哩咕信息科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202010789922.0/2.html,转载请声明来源钻瓜专利网。